➢ Question about alleviating congestion from rush hour traffic along Marine View
Drive at SR 529. Corey added there is a plan in studying the interchange and
prospective impro. WSDOT has been asked about limiting the opening of the
bridge during congested periods, authority is under the Coast Guard’s jurisdiction
and existing laws make it difficult to allow requests to restrict the opening of the
bridge. WSDOT is planning a mechanical rehabilitation and painting project in
2023 for the northbound Snohomish River Bridge which will be high impact.

ENGINEERING REPORT
➢ 2022 Pavement Maintenance Overlay paving is underway.
➢ Pavement grinding on Silver Lake Drive to begin next week. Pavement markings for Silver
Lake Loop will be done in Spring 2023.
➢ Interurban Trail to YMCA – construction of pedestrian improvements are underway.
1 |Page
➢ Active Connections - Fleming Bicycle Corridor – WSDOT has plan specs and estimates for
review, WSDOT approval is required for obligation of construction grant funding.
TRAFFIC ENGINEERING REPORT
➢ Speed limit reduction sign installation on Hwy 99 is complete.
➢ Photo Enforcement – Purchasing/Procurement Division is negotiating contracts to
bring before Council to authorize the Mayor to sign. Expected in early October.
➢ Public Works striping crew is finishing up downtown pavement markings, including
parking lines and painted curbs.
➢ Work on overhead street name signs that are faded will begin this Fall when striping
season concludes
➢ Preconstruction conference for Revive I-5 was held, contractor has been selected and
overnight and weekend closures will begin in early October.
➢ Short presentation on crash data.
POLICE REPORT
➢ Enforcement activities by Airport Road have significantly decreased pedestrian fatalities
since the beginning of the year.
TRANSIT REPORT
➢ Transit is in process of planning stage for March 2023 service changes.
